What Are Protein Production Services and How Do They Work?
Protein production services are pivotal in the biotechnology and pharmaceutical industries, facilitating the creation of recombinant proteins for research, diagnostics, and therapeutic applications. These services encompass the entire process, from gene synthesis to protein purification, ensuring that proteins meet the necessary quality and quantity standards.
What Are Protein Production Services?
Protein production services involve the engineered
production of proteins using recombinant DNA technology. This process typically
includes several key stages:
- Gene
     Synthesis and Cloning: The gene encoding the desired protein is
     synthesized and inserted into an appropriate expression vector.
 - Transformation
     and Expression: The recombinant vector is introduced into a host
     organism (such as E. coli, yeast, insect, or mammalian cells),
     which then expresses the protein.
 - Protein
     Purification: The expressed protein is extracted and purified using
     various chromatographic techniques to achieve the desired purity.
 - Characterization
     and Quality Control: The purified protein undergoes rigorous testing
     to confirm its identity, activity, and purity.
 
These services are crucial for producing proteins that are
consistent, functional, and suitable for their intended applications.
Expression Systems Used in Protein Production
The choice of expression system depends on the specific
requirements of the protein being produced:
- Bacterial
     Systems (e.g., E. coli): Ideal for producing large quantities
     of proteins quickly and cost-effectively. However, they may not perform
     complex post-translational modifications.
 - Yeast
     Systems: Offer advantages of eukaryotic systems, including the ability
     to perform some post-translational modifications, and are suitable for
     large-scale production.
 - Insect
     Cells: Used for proteins requiring more complex modifications,
     providing a balance between cost and functionality.
 - Mammalian
     Cells: Preferred for proteins that require complex post-translational
     modifications, such as glycosylation, essential for therapeutic
     applications.
 
Each system has its advantages and limitations, and the
choice depends on factors like the complexity of the protein, production scale,
and intended use. 
Applications of Protein Production Services
Protein production services are integral to various sectors:
- Research
     and Development: Facilitate the study of protein functions and
     interactions, aiding in the discovery of new drug targets.
 - Diagnostics:
     Enable the production of antigens and antibodies for diagnostic assays.
 - Therapeutics:
     Support the development of therapeutic proteins, including monoclonal
     antibodies and vaccines.
 - Industrial
     Biotechnology: Contribute to the production of enzymes and other
     proteins used in manufacturing processes.
 
The versatility of protein production services makes them
indispensable across these applications.
Challenges in Protein Production
Despite advancements, several challenges persist in protein
production:
- Protein
     Solubility: Ensuring that the produced protein is soluble and
     functional.
 - Post-Translational
     Modifications: Achieving the correct modifications, especially in
     non-bacterial systems.
 - Scalability:
     Transferring laboratory-scale processes to industrial-scale production
     without loss of quality.
 - Cost:
     Balancing production costs with the need for high-quality proteins.
 
Addressing these challenges requires expertise and
experience in protein production technologies.
